Generator Health provides an operational backbone for health-tech platforms by managing patient prescription access. It combines trained specialists with AI to handle prior authorizations, insurance workflows, pharmacy coordination, and provider communications, speeding up approvals and dispensing. The human-in-the-loop model uses operator-derived data to train proprietary AI, making workflows smarter over time and enabling partner platforms to scale care delivery. Its goal is to reduce delays in medication access, improve patient outcomes, and support partners with reliable, scalable prescription access operations.

Simplify's Take

What believers are saying

  • AI-assisted prior authorization can reduce friction and accelerate patient medication access.
  • Operational data from frontline cases can improve automation and workflow quality over time.
  • Partnerships with health-tech platforms expand demand without building in-house access teams.

What critics are saying

  • Competitors like Owkin and Commure compress pricing and make insourcing easier.
  • Heavy reliance on manual specialists exposes margins to hiring constraints and volume swings.
  • Payer rule changes can force more manual work, raising costs and slowing approvals.

What makes Generator Health unique

  • Human-in-the-loop ops power prescription access across insurance, pharmacy, and provider workflows.
  • 2023-founded company positions itself as healthcare technology's operational backbone.
  • Specialists generate labeled data while resolving administrative edge cases for AI improvement.
